Antioxidant and oxidant potential of Rosa canina

Öz:
The present study aimed to determine the total antioxidant status, total oxidant status and oxidative stress index of the ethanol extracts obtained from the fruits of Rosa caninaL. plant collected in Erzincanprovince (Turkey). In this context, the fruit samples of the plant were extracted with ethanol (EtOH) using a Soxhlet device. Total antioxidant status (TAS), total oxidant status (TOS) and oxidative stress index (OSI) were determined using Rel Assay kits. It was determined that the TAS value of the plantwas 4.602mmol/L,the TOS value was 6.294μmol/Land the OSI was 0.138.As a result, R. caninaexhibited high antioxidant activities.
